Aviator Algorithm Explained: How the Game Really Works
How Aviator works behind the scenes. Provably fair RNG, server seeds, multiplier distribution and why you can't predict outcomes.
Most Aviator players have no idea how the game actually works under the hood. They see a plane fly, a multiplier tick up, and a random crash point. They wonder: is this rigged? Can it be predicted? How is the crash point decided?
This article explains the provably fair algorithm behind Aviator in plain English — no math degree required. Understanding this will make you a smarter player and protect you from scam predictor apps.
The Big Picture: What is Provably Fair?
Aviator (created by Spribe in 2019) uses a provably fair system. That means:
- The casino can't cheat — outcomes are determined by cryptographic hashes BEFORE the round starts
- Players can verify any past round's outcome themselves
- Even Spribe (the developer) can't change a round's result mid-game
This is fundamentally different from old-school online casino games that used proprietary RNGs you had to trust. With provably fair, trust is replaced by math.
Play provably fair Aviator on 1Win
Play Aviator on 1Win →The Three Seeds That Determine Each Round
1. Server Seed (the casino's secret)
Before each round, the casino server generates a random string (e.g. 9f3a8b2c4d5e6f7a...). This is the "server seed."
2. Client Seed (you contribute)
Your browser sends a random string too. You can usually customize this in the game settings — set it to anything you want. Default is auto-generated.
3. Nonce (round counter)
A simple counter that increments by 1 each round. Round 1: nonce = 1. Round 2: nonce = 2. Etc.
How the Multiplier is Calculated
Once the round starts, the algorithm:
- Combines:
server_seed + client_seed + nonce - Hashes the combination with HMAC-SHA-512
- Extracts a specific portion of the hash as a number
- Maps that number to a multiplier using a fixed mathematical formula
The formula is designed to produce a probability distribution where:
- ~3% of rounds instantly crash at 1.00x (the "house edge" rounds)
- ~50% crash below 2x
- ~20% crash between 2x-5x
- ~10% crash above 5x
- ~1% crash above 100x (rare big wins)
How You Can Verify Past Rounds
After each round, the casino reveals the original server seed. You can then:
- Take the revealed server seed
- Combine with your client seed and the nonce of that round
- Hash it with HMAC-SHA-512
- Run it through the formula
- Compare the result to the actual multiplier the round produced
If they match (they always will on legitimate casinos), the round was fair. If they don't match, the casino cheated. You can do this for any past round.
Why Predictors Can't Work
Predicting the next multiplier would require knowing the server seed BEFORE the round. But:
- The server seed is generated server-side, you don't have access to it
- Only the SHA-256 hash is published before the round (a one-way function)
- Breaking SHA-256 would require more computing power than the entire Bitcoin network
Conclusion:Any "predictor" that claims to forecast multipliers is either lying about its capabilities or doesn't actually predict anything (just shows random numbers). See our predictor scam exposé.
Play provably fair Aviator — verify every round yourself
Play Aviator on 1Win →The Math: Multiplier Distribution
Aviator's multiplier distribution follows roughly an inverse function:P(multiplier > x) ≈ 0.97/x
This means:
- P(multiplier > 2x) ≈ 48.5%
- P(multiplier > 5x) ≈ 19.4%
- P(multiplier > 10x) ≈ 9.7%
- P(multiplier > 100x) ≈ 0.97%
- P(multiplier > 1000x) ≈ 0.097%
The 0.97 numerator is what creates the 3% house edge. If it were 1.0, the game would have 0% house edge (no profit for casino). At 0.97, the casino keeps 3% over the long run.
Common Misconceptions
❌ "The plane was bound to crash early after that 50x round"
Wrong. Each round is independent — the previous round's outcome has zero impact on the next. This is the gambler's fallacy.
❌ "The casino can manipulate outcomes against me"
Not possible on provably fair systems. The seed is committed before the round starts, hashed publicly. Any tampering would be mathematically detectable.
❌ "Big wins after midnight are more likely"
Time of day has zero impact. The algorithm doesn't know what time it is.
❌ "If I bet small enough, the algorithm gives me wins"
Wrong. The algorithm doesn't know or care about your bet size. The multiplier is determined before you even click "Bet."
What This Means For Your Strategy
Knowing the math, the optimal Aviator strategy is:
- Cash out at low multipliers (1.5x-2x) where probability is high (~50-66%)
- Never chase big multipliers — variance will kill you
- Bet small portions of bankroll (1-2%) to survive variance
- Ignore patterns from previous rounds — they don't exist
See our full how to win Aviator guide for proven strategies based on this math.
FAQ
Where do I verify my Aviator rounds?
In Aviator's game menu, click "Provably Fair" → "Verify." You can paste any past round's seeds and check the result yourself.
Can the casino see my client seed before the round?
Yes, but they've already committed to the server seed (via published hash). They can't change it after seeing yours.
Is Aviator the same on every casino?
Yes — Spribe provides the same Aviator game to all licensed casinos. Only the RTP varies slightly (96-97% depending on casino agreement).
Ready to start playing?
Play Aviator on 1Win — 500% Bonus →